It’s been very, very quiet in Mets Land since MLB’s announcement on Monday regarding the stealing of signs investigation. SU has been looking for signs at Citi Field – will it be white smoke or black smoke?
SU says the key question for the Mets is what did Beltran share in his interview for the managerial position? Did he lie about his role in the Astros’ scandal? Or was he forthcoming? At this point, we know that no player has been disciplined for their actions on the Astros, and we can assume the same for the Red Sox. We know that Beltran is the only player cited by name in MLB’s report. We know he has a long history of stealing signs “the old fashioned way” without the use of technology, and that he was very good at it. What if it turns out Verlander was a key guy in translating the signs of opponents for his hitters?
SU has read a number of articles this week about the future treatment of Hinch and Cora. The consensus seems to be that both will find their way back into some baseball related role once time goes by, and that could easily be a managerial role. Interesting. Mark McGwire has gotten jobs and certainly A-Rod is everywhere. The reality is that people are forgiving, and especially in sports where if you are contrite, people will forgive and forget.
What is interesting is that Beltran doesn’t come with a track record of managing that would make you say, “man, we can’t let this guy get away.” He has never managed anywhere at any level.
SU’s advice: keep Beltran, have him answer questions with the media, and show major, major contrition. He has time before the season starts to answer a ton of questions and get this out of the way. SU says the reality in baseball is that Barry Bonds could be named the manager of some team tomorrow or even Sammy Sosa or Mark McGwire (or even A-Rod!). A player who used PEDs does not translate into allowing all of your players to do it. But you have to come clean and admit that you were wrong and what you did was wrong. This will dog Beltran for some time – no doubt.
